Why Choose the ABB ACS880-01-248A-7+N7502 Industrial Drive?

The ABB ACS880-01-248A-7+N7502 is a high-performance AC variable frequency drive (VFD) engineered for demanding industrial applications requiring precise speed and torque control. Part of the advanced ABB ACS880 industrial drive series, this drive is designed to provide reliable operation, energy efficiency and flexible integration within modern automation systems.

Built on ABB's all-compatible drive architecture, the ACS880-01 incorporates advanced motor control technology, integrated harmonic mitigation and extensive connectivity options. Its compact wall-mounted design simplifies installation while delivering dependable performance in challenging industrial environments.

With a rated output power of 200 kW and a three-phase 525–690 V AC supply, the ACS880-01-248A-7+N7502 is ideally suited for conveyors, pumps, fans, compressors, mixers, cranes and other heavy-duty industrial applications. The integrated +N7502 SynRM motor support package enables optimised operation with ABB synchronous reluctance motors.

Advanced Motor Control for Industrial Processes

The ACS880-01 series provides precise motor control through ABB's Direct Torque Control technology, enabling accurate speed regulation, fast response times and improved process efficiency. This helps reduce mechanical stress on equipment while supporting consistent production quality.

Designed for industries including mining, metals, chemicals, cement, power generation, material handling, pulp and paper, marine, water treatment, food and beverage and automotive manufacturing, the ACS880 platform offers the flexibility required for modern industrial applications.

Technical Specifications

Power 200 kW
Current 248 A
Voltage 690 V
Phase Three Phase
IP Rating IP21
Series ACS880 Industrial Drives
Product ID 3AXD50000035945
Product type AC variable frequency drive
Rated output power 200 kW
Rated output current 248 A
Input voltage 525–690 V AC
Input phases 3-phase
Frequency 47.5–63 Hz
Protection rating IP21
Enclosure type NEMA Type 1
Mounting type Wall-mounted
Dimensions (H × W × D) 955 × 380 × 413 mm
Weight 95 kg
Country of origin Finland
Country of Manufacture Finland
EMC Filter None

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the ABB ACS880-01-248A-7+N7502 used for?

This drive controls the speed and torque of large three-phase AC motors used in demanding industrial and process applications.

What motor power is supported by this drive?

The drive supports motors with a rated output power of up to 200 kW.

What supply voltage does the drive require?

The ACS880-01-248A-7+N7502 operates from a three-phase 525–690 V AC supply.

What does the +N7502 option provide?

The +N7502 option enables optimised operation with ABB synchronous reluctance (SynRM) motors.

Where is this drive typically installed?

The drive is designed for wall-mounted installation within industrial electrical rooms, control panels and production facilities.
